Block 681556

8f0859ccdc1da1bec7b3f55eb2768479e9bcd3eed9b75325f345cc4d7e9e3f56
Transactions1
Height681556
Confirmations4557708
TimestampSat, 25 Apr 2015 14:57:16 UTC
Size (bytes)211
Version2
Merkle Root60677bde6b83aff58d3dd77e32649d61ba3c3ca1e8fc6ccfe5493aa7d90a7f35
Nonce157246
Bits1c1ec697
Difficulty8.318112923721776

Transactions

No Inputs (Newly Generated Coins)
Fee: 0 FTC
4557708 Confirmations80 FTC